  5. What matters to me most about education are the influence and effects of data-driven instruction. Referring to how schools and teachers are motivated by the pending results of standardized testing and how that effects student learning. One article that relates to this is the article “The Dangers of Data Driven Instruction” by Susan B. Neuman. This article gives a critical look at data in the classroom and how it can hinder students instead of its intended benefits. Throughout my siblings and my own school experiences, I have seen how data driven instruction and standardized testing can hurt students. Because of this, I find the topic and the issue to be especially pressing within classrooms today.
